Library Services
The Primate Center Library serves the information needs of Center scientists, affiliates, support staff, visiting scientists, and students. Complementing the Center's outreach programs and the Center's commitment to serve as an international resource, the library offers its services to faculty and students of the University of Wisconsin-Madison, to the 8 NCRR Primate Centers, and to primatologists worldwide.
